🕹️ About Pexy.io – Because Pixel is sEXY!
Hi, I’m Kornel Kolma, and Pexy.io is my personal passion project – a lovingly curated collection of the best browser games from the past and present.
The name Pexy comes from a simple idea: Pixel is sexy. For those of us who grew up playing Flash games, loading DOS classics on floppy disks, or coding for retro platforms like the C64 and Plus/4, there’s a real charm in the pixels of the past – and they deserve to be seen, played, and preserved.
🎮 What is Pexy.io?
At its heart, Pexy.io is a curated browser game archive. Much like the Internet Archive’s game section, this platform aims to bring back the great classics – but with a personal twist. Every game is hand-selected, carefully documented, and made playable directly in your browser. No installations, no interruptions, and absolutely no in-game ads.
Whether it’s a forgotten Flash gem, a weird HTML5 indie, or a retro DOS platformer, if it’s fun or fascinating, I want it here.
